Since becoming part of HCA Healthcare in 2018, Memorial Health has continued to make a positive impact in the 35+ counties it serves across southeast Georgia and southern South Carolina. In addition to Memorial Health University Medical Center, the Memorial Health network of care includes the Memorial Health Dwaine & Cynthia Willett Children’s Hospital of Savannah, primary and specialty care doctors, business services and Consult-A-Nurse®️, our 24-hour call center. We also have a major medical education program that trains residents in numerous specialties. Memorial Health aims is to provide a culture of caring for both our patients and colleagues.

    This week, we hosted 15 students from the City of Savannah's Moses Jackson Community Center's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Robotics Summer Camp. The students watched Dr. Jason McClune and his team demonstrate the latest robotic bronchoscopy technology for diagnosing lung cancer and had the opportunity to drive the device. Dr. Tim Connelly discussed the advantages (and drawbacks) of AI in healthcare. And, Dr. Chip Barnes explained the benefits of robotic-assisted surgeries and demonstrated how these surgeries are performed. Each student was given the opportunity to use the robot to perform a suture procedure. It was a great day of learning and fun with these bright young students.
